First pull list of the new year is a fairly light one. Only three books this week so I ended up splurging and getting the 1st volume Little, Brown Books for Young Readers' The Adventures of Tintin. Which, as one of the cornerstones for Eurpeon comics, is something I've long been meaning to check out...

From the Wednesday pulls the first book is a new iZombie which has nerds playing something like D&D and Horatio and Gwen spend their first date at the local minigolf...

The inaccurately titled 2nd issue of the Black Hands 2010 Special also arrives. And with some bribery Weird Pete is elected as the Black Hands GM. Who finds himself struggling to fufill the promises he's made of running the Greatest Cattlepunk Campaign Ever...

Lastly is The Thanos Imperative: Devastation one-shot. Which serves as both a coda to Nova, Guardians of the Galaxy and The Thanos Imperative. And a prequel to upcoming ongoing cosmic Abnett/Lanning book The Annihilators. Which makes me happy to see that Cosmic Marvel isn't being abandonded and that the book will feature a back-up following the adventures of Rocket Raccoon and Groot...

I was more than pleasantly surprised at how funny a movie starring Slyvester Stallone as a Prohibition-era mob boss trying to go straight could be. It had a real old-school Marx Brothers classic comedy feel to it. Chaz Palmeterri's dim bulb goomba is a real stand-out as well. But really, Stallone shows some truly good comedy chops here...
